Process Design:ÌýI use AspenPlusâ„¢, Aspen HYSYSâ„¢, Aspen Energy Analyzerâ„¢, Aspen COMThermo Workbenchâ„¢, and SuperPro Designerâ„¢ process simulation programs to develop process designs for ferrite, ZnO, and MnO water splitting cycles as well as biomass conversion processes. Then using the Department of Energy’s H2A hydrogen production analysis program and guidelines, I can evaluate the process economics and feasibility.

Catalytic Microchannel Reactors:ÌýThe goal of this research is to investigate microchannel catalysis of various reactions including fuel production from synthesis gas.

Thermal Energy Storage Materials:ÌýThe objective of this research is to study high temperature thermal energy storage of mixed metal ferrites for steam production from chemical and sensible heat recovery.Ìý Ìý
